Oracle 9i database server and Space
Hi,
I am new to Oracle. I installed 9i database server ( personal edition) on my machine at home just to play around and get a feel of Oracle. Unfortunately within a month my Harddrive was maxed out to full capacity of 72 Gigs. I had only used 12 Gigs when I first installed Oracle a month ago. I had to uninstall it completely from my computer. I am wondering if anyone has had this problem or how to rectify the problem
Thanks
RishiAs Justin said, verify all trace files.
You can see with sqlplus where they are
SQL> show parameter dump_dest
NAME TYPE VALUE
background_dump_dest string E:\oracle\admin\demo9i\bdump
core_dump_dest string E:\oracle\admin\demo9i\cdump
user_dump_dest string E:\oracle\admin\demo9i\udump
SQL> And you can see the size of each datafiles too, and verify if your undotbs is not in autoextend mode (it can growth) :
1 select substr(file_name,1,50), bytes/1024/1024 SizeMb, autoextensible
2 from dba_data_files
3 union
4 select substr(file_name,1,50), bytes/1024/1024 SizeMb, autoextensible
5 from dba_temp_files
6 union
7 select substr(a.member,1,50), bytes/1024/1024, ' '
8* from v$logfile a, v$log b where a.group#=b.group#
SQL> /
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\CWMLITE01.DBF 20 YES
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\DRSYS01.DBF 20 YES
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\EXAMPLE01.DBF 149,375 YES
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\INDX01.DBF 25 YES
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\ODM01.DBF 20 YES
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\REDO01_1.LOG 100
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\REDO02_1.LOG 100
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\REDO03_1.LOG 100
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\SYSTEM01.DBF 430 YES
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\TBS_TST_01.DBF 2 NO
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\TEMP01.DBF 40 NO
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\TOOLS01.DBF 10 YES
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\UNDOTBS01.DBF 405 YES
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\USERS01.DBF 25 YES
E:\ORACLE\ORADATA\DEMO9I\XDB01.DBF 46,875 YES
15 rows selected.
SQL> And to verify if you generate archivelog :
SQL> conn / as sysdba
Connected.
SQL> archive log list
Database log mode No Archive Mode
Automatic archival Disabled
Archive destination E:\oracle\ora92\RDBMS
Oldest online log sequence 38
Current log sequence 40
SQL> HTH,
Nicolas.

Difference between Tom Cat Server,Apache Server and IIS
HI
While looking at the exsting threads i saw someone posted something about these servers . But i',m still confused. Should i use both Tom cat and Apache or only apache to develop the web application. If yes then can i use Tom Cat with Apache
Thanks
CookieWell Apache is just a webserver that serves static webpages. Tomcat is used to interpret JSP's and serve servlets. If you plan to use JSP or Servlets, out of your choices, you'll have to use Tomcat. Speaking generally, you could probably use Tomcat for everything; it too can serve static webpages, but for a professional project, you'd probably want to use both Apache and Tomcat. IIS is overkill unless you're going to ASP.
Michael Bishop -

Auditing in oracle 10g database and oracle 10g application server
Dear friends,
We have oracle 10g application server and oracle 10g database server in place.My criteria is to audit users connected using oracle application user credentials to the database.
Can you please tell me how can i do it.
Thanks & regards,Its the database connection you want to track. The session audit will show where it came from.
Auditing is turned using this command:
alter system set audit_trail = DB scope=spfile;
Note: The use of spfile will require a DB bounce before audit starts
To audit Sessions:
audit create session;
Query by Audit Type:
SELECT A.USERNAME,
OS_USERNAME,
A.TIMESTAMP,
A.RETURNCODE,
TERMINAL,
USERHOST
FROM DBA_AUDIT_SESSION A
WHERE USERHOST = <replace with iAS servername> ;
By User
SELECT USERNAME,OBJ_NAME,ACTION_NAME , TIMESTAMP
FROM DBA_AUDIT_TRAIL WHERE USERNAME = 'SCOTT';
Check for users sharing database accounts
select count(distinct(terminal)),username
from dba_audit_session
having count(distinct(terminal))>1
group by username;
Attempts to access the database at unusual hours
SELECT username, terminal, action_name, returncode,
TO_CHAR (TIMESTAMP, 'DD-MON-YYYY HH24:MI:SS'),
TO_CHAR (logoff_time, 'DD-MON-YYYY HH24:MI:SS')
FROM dba_audit_session
WHERE TO_DATE (TO_CHAR (TIMESTAMP, 'HH24:MI:SS'), 'HH24:MI:SS') <
TO_DATE ('08:00:00', 'HH24:MI:SS')
OR TO_DATE (TO_CHAR (TIMESTAMP, 'HH24:MI:SS'), 'HH24:MI:SS') >
TO_DATE ('19:30:00', 'HH24:MI:SS');
Attempts to access the database with non-existent users
SELECT username, terminal, TO_CHAR (TIMESTAMP, 'DD-MON-YYYY HH24:MI:SS')
FROM dba_audit_session
WHERE returncode <> 0
AND NOT EXISTS (SELECT 'x'
FROM dba_users
WHERE dba_users.username = dba_audit_session.username);
Other audits you might consider:
audit grant any object privilege;
audit alter user;
audit create user;
audit drop user;
audit drop tablespace;
audit grant any role;
audit grant any privilege;
audit alter system;
audit alter session;
audit delete on AUD$ by access;
audit insert on AUD$ by access;
audit update on AUD$ by access;
audit delete table;
audit create tablespace;
audit alter database;
audit create role;
audit create table;
audit alter any procedure;
audit create view;
audit drop any procedure;
audit drop profile;
audit alter profile;
audit alter any table;
audit create public database link;
Best Regards
mseberg -
